We create world-class content, which we distribute across our portfolio of film, television, and streaming, and bring to life through our theme parks and consumer experiences. We own and operate leading entertainment and news brands, including NBC, NBC News, MSNBC, CNBC, NBC Sports, Telemundo, NBC Local Stations, Bravo, USA Network, and Peacock, our premium ad-supported streaming service. We produce and distribute premier filmed entertainment and programming through Universal Filmed Entertainment Group and Universal Studio Group, and have world-renowned theme parks and attractions through Universal Destinations & Experiences. NBCUniversal is a subsidiary of Comcast Corporation.

NBCUniversal Local is looking for a passionate, results-oriented, and motivated self-starter to support innovation in our Ad Impact efforts for the NBC, Telemundo, and Regional Sports Network portfolio. Ad Impact builds strategic partnerships with agencies and clients for the measurement of the effectiveness of advertiser campaigns and sponsorships across NBCU content, platforms, and partnerships. This position will support the upper management, playing a key role in digital and convergent data tactics, strategies, and data storytelling to ensure operational efficiency of cross-funnel campaign measurement from end-to-end to ensure maximum effectiveness of advertiser campaigns and sponsorships.
You will report to the Manager, Ad Impact. The Analyst's responsibilities will include:
• Collaborate with all our internal business partners (sales, analytics, and operations teams) to ensure that our solutions will be robust, comprehensive, and performant
• Work closely with outside vendors to manage campaign tracking and measurement plans
• Report monthly on attribution metrics and serve as onboarding expert for all clients and ad sales team
• Analyze and visualize data and insights to communicate findings clearly and concisely
• Adherence to project milestones and delivery of results within tight deadlines
• Work with senior research management in evaluating new research tools and other data sources to understand capabilities and potential benefits
• Stay current on media and digital analytics, audience measurement best practices, announcements, and industry research
